Burlington Couple Plan Observance of The ir 50th Wedding AnniversaryMR. AND MRS. THEODORE RICHTER.Sunday Mr. and Mrs. Theodore Theodore Richter and ElizabethVos were married Feb. 7, 1888, following which they lived for 10 years on a farm on the River road. 10 miks south-east of Burlington, after which thry purchased a farm near Wheatland, in the town of Burlington, where they resided until they retired and moved to Burlington 18 years ago.With them on their anniversary will be their nine children, Frank Richter. Brighton: Mrs. Joe Daniels, Brighton; William Richter, Silver I.ake; Elmer Richter. Brighton: Mrs. Leo Robers, Salem; Mrs. Sylvester Epping, Salem; Mrs. .Jake Robers, Lyons; Mrs. Clarence Fonk, Kenosha, Mrs. Stanley Kelly, Burlington, and their 40 grandchildren.Richter will keep open house attheir home at 647 Washington street, from 2 to 5 p. m. and 7 to8 p. m., on the occasion of theirfiftieth wedding anniversary.On Monday, the date of their anniversary, they will renew their vows at a high mass at St. Charles' church, at which Rev. F. J. Hillen-brand, pastor of St. Charles, will officiate. With them will be Ben Vos, and Mrs. Ben Rothering, who were their attendants 59 years tgo. when they were married at St. Alphonsus’ church, N e\v Munster. Following the mass, a “wedding dinner” will be served in St. Charles’ hall to a party of 60 relatives and friends.‘:
